Subject: Partner SFTP drop — new owner

Hi,

As you review the pending changes to the Harborline ingest scripts, note that ownership of the partner SFTP drop is changing at the end of the month. This includes key rotation, the nightly pull job, and the quarantine folder for malformed files. Review comments on the retry logic should still go through the normal PR flow, but questions about drop-folder conventions or partner onboarding now go to the new owner. The incoming owner is listed below.

signatory, tagaf-bahaf: Praael Fenmir Rusok

Handover for the eng sync — CrashFunnel pipeline

Handing this off to Priya before I rotate onto the Oatfield project. Quick state of things: symbolication is stable, the dedup service still hiccups on the big Monday batches, and there's a half-finished retry queue in the `batch-retry` branch. Nothing's on fire, just needs babysitting during release weeks. All the context, dashboards, and my TODO list are on the internal page below.

operations page: https://jenkins.zemvarcloud.local/job/merge_requests/repo/build/73930b4b30f0a8ed

Welcome to on-call for the Glimmerpane design system! Our snapshot tests live in the `snapcheck` suite and run on every merge to main. If a UI component changes visually, the diff bot flags it — usually it's an intentional tweak, so just approve the new baseline. If it's 2am and snapshots are failing across the board, it's almost always a font-loading race, not your problem. To unlock the baseline store and re-approve snapshots in bulk, use the recovery passphrase below.

recovery phrase for tahag-taguf: wenix-caswyn

Nightly search reindex (Burrowlight catalog). The job kicks off at 02:15 and usually wraps in forty minutes; if it runs past an hour, check the Mirebrook queue for stuck shards before panicking. Reindex output is swapped atomically, so a failed run leaves the old index intact. To trigger a manual run, the job manifest must be signed with the key below.

rollout seal: bky4_x7Gc